Retail fun-ness
I work in a retail clothing store, with 3 Letters as their name.. let's call them You Ess See...

Anyway, I have 5 managers:
Anne - the stockroom bitch. This mental shouted at me for saying "fuck" in the stockroom, at 8am, before the store was open. Apparently customers can hear you in a stock room.

Rab - the mens floor manager. He is a legend, works in a bar too, and got me in for free last night as I just turned 18. Free drinks were all around! He often comes into work drunk, and during our tidy up period he'll say something like "Right lads, get tidied and dick about for a bit". And will then go about calling me a crazy cunt, mocking other members of staff (in a playful way) and will randomly burst into '80s songs.

Kerry - the office manager. She's immensely sound! One of my favourite managers ever and is probably the manager I work hardest under in said clothing store! Can have a joke about, get work done, run out to the shop etc. I look forward going into work when she's in.

Gary - the store manager. He openly hates the place, yet like many store managers is an absolute perfectionist. Nice, genuine guy, good taste in music, is a drummer, and hasn't given me disciplinarys when I really should've had some! The only downer is that he's ginger.

Then there's Elaine - the Assistant manager / ladies floor manager. She is the person that hired me yet seems to hate me with a passion. Now the store I work in isn't exactly the best paid, and they expect you to spend all yer wages on the clothes as 'uniform'. So, I got a job in a sports fashion retail shop - we'll call them JC Sports... so, I phone up the first store on tuesday to check when I'm working and Elaine answers the phone. This is a fairly accurate account of the conversation I had with her.
"Alright Elaine, it's Colin, can you tell me when I'm working again?"
"Erm, not really, Colin..."
"Ok, I'll phone back later then."
"No, wait. I've had a discussion with Gary and we both feel that it'd be better if you don't work here anymore. The fact that you have another job means you are no good for us as it's conflict of interest..."
"Ok, is Gary in?"
"No, Gary's on holiday."
"When did you speak to him?"

She stuttered, said that, instead of sacking me, she wants me to hand in my notice with immediate effect. I'm questioning that as possibly unfair dismissal and will appeal it, just to waste time and resources.
I still sort of work there though, as Kerry & Rab still want me there. And I respond to those two people.

Apologies for length / lack of sense this may have made. I'm hungover. Big time.
